1991 Chevrolet K1500 4x4 Standard Cab, Short box Silverado Pickup.  116,036 miles.  A/C blows cold, Heat works very well.  All the dash controls and radio works well.  Engine, I think, was rebuilt and carburetor and aluminum intake installed.  MSD Distributor and coil.  Truck starts right up, runs very good.  I have put about 2-thousand miles on it, and it has not burned any oil.  Starts very well, runs good, no smoking. 

I have installed a new battery, a new alternator, new front brakes (pads, calipers and rubber lines) and new ABS controls and modules.  Everything works as it should.  When I bought the truck, the dealer had replaced the rear end with a unit from a Tahoe, with bigger rear brakes.  The rear brakes worked TOO well, so I installed an adjustable proportioning valve and cut the pressure to the rear brakes.  They now work as they should, the truck stops really well.  Once in a while, when you start the truck, the ABS light comes on, but turns off within a minute.  Must be re-booting itself?

Newer tires with lots of tread left.  I have had those Road Force balanced, at 70-mph the truck drives down the road very smooth.  Wheels some discoloration, need to be polished.

Interior shows some wear on the driver’s seat.  Carpet is good; I put new rubber mats in it.  The left hinge is broken on the glove box door, needs to re-glued.  Everything works inside, all the lights, radio, wipers, etc.  Everything on the truck works as it should.  Everything.

Body shows no rust or bubbles, but I think it was re-painted a while ago.  Paint is very nice.  Headlights and tail-lights need to be polished and brought back to clear.  Frame is starting to show surface rust.  Under the bed, the cross braces have some rust thru.  Dual exhaust is good, but not stock.

I bought this truck Early July to use as a second truck, a backup.  I sold the Dodge Dually and bought a newer Chevrolet, so I am going to sell this truck.  I needed another truck for when the Dodge was constantly in the shop! 

I have tinkered with this truck since I bought it, fixing all the little things.  It runs and drives very nice.  Everything works, even the windshield washers.  I would not be afraid to drive this truck anyplace.

NHTSA approves hybrid rearview mirror display in Cadillac CT6, Bolt EV

Tue, Feb 23 2016

The Chevy Bolt EV prototype doesn't just have a fancy new all-electric powertrain. Just outside the driver's line of sight is a newfangled rearview mirror, one that can turn into a screen that shows a moving image from the rear-facing camera. Speaking to NPR's Robert Siegel yesterday, Department of Transportation secretary Anthony Foxx said that NHTSA has now approved this type of mirror/screen for use in vehicles. According to a letter from NHTSA to General Motors, GM will likely use this Full Display Mirror first in the 2016 Cadillac CT6 before coming to the Bolt. In its letter to GM, NHTSA said that the Full Display Mirror will only qualify as a standard rearview mirror as long as there are normal side mirrors in place. Pushing Back: GM expanding Chevrolet into Korea, Daewoo out

Thu, 29 Apr 2010

Chevrolet Camaro goes to South Korea - Click above for high-res image
General Motors decided several years ago to begin heavily promoting Chevrolet as its global mainstream brand even in markets where its existing brands like Opel and Daewoo were a dominant force. Today, at the Busan Motor Show in South Korea, GM Daewoo president Mike Arcamone announced that the Camaro would lead the way in GM's efforts to market Chevrolet in South Korea.
For now at least Chevrolet and Daewoo-branded vehicles will coexist in the Korean market. However, while we were in China last week GM officials told us that the Daewoo brand, which has been somewhat tainted by past quality issues, would eventually be phased out in favor of Chevrolet. When the new Aveo launches next year it will likely be badged as a Chevrolet even though GM Daewoo is in charge of engineering the car.

Chevy Gives World Series MVP Madison Bumgarner A Recalled Truck

Thu, Oct 30 2014

Last night must have seemed like a dream come true for San Francisco Giants pitcher Madison Bumgarner. He helped his team win its third World Series Championship in four years, earned MVP status and was given a brand new 2015 Chevrolet Colorado. Bumgarner might want to hold off on taking a victory lap in his new truck however. The Colorado is currently under recall. General Motors issued a stop-delivery order earlier this month to fix the truck's air bag connectors, which were wired improperly during the manufacturing process. The faulty wiring can cause the system to deploy incorrectly.
